Understanding Low-Latency Gaming
Low-latency gaming refers to playing video games with minimal delay between a player’s action and the game’s response. This requires hardware and software optimized to reduce input lag, ensuring a seamless gaming experience. High-performance mice, keyboards, and network setups are crucial components in achieving this goal.
The Endgame Gear Op1we
The Endgame Gear Op1we is a lightweight, high-precision gaming mouse designed specifically for competitive gamers. Its features include:
- Optical sensor with up to 19,000 DPI
- Zero smoothing, filtering, or acceleration
- Lightweight construction at approximately 62 grams
- Programmable buttons for customization
- High polling rate of 1000Hz
These features collectively contribute to reduced input lag and precise control, which are essential for high-stakes gaming scenarios.
